diff --git a/.github/workflows/release.yml b/.github/workflows/release.yml index ff4f96f..45d3764 100644 --- a/.github/workflows/release.yml +++ b/.github/workflows/release.yml @@ -18,6 +18,6 @@ jobs: registry-server: ghcr.io registry-username: ${{ github.actor }} image: ${{ github.repository }} - version: 0.17.0 + version: 0.18.0 secrets: pull-request-token: ${{ secrets.GH_ORG_PAT }} diff --git a/.github/workflows/test.yml b/.github/workflows/test.yml index 5a79ea9..b37dc51 100644 --- a/.github/workflows/test.yml +++ b/.github/workflows/test.yml @@ -14,7 +14,7 @@ jobs: name: Integration Tests strategy: matrix: - k8s_version: [v1.27, v1.28, v1.29] + k8s_version: [v1.28, v1.29, v1.30] permissions: contents: read uses: kadras-io/github-reusable-workflows/.github/workflows/carvel-package-test-integration.yml@main diff --git a/Makefile b/Makefile index 5ba5c07..663175c 100644 --- a/Makefile +++ b/Makefile @@ -1,4 +1,4 @@ -K8S_VERSION=v1.29 +K8S_VERSION=v1.30 # Build package configuration build: package diff --git a/README.md b/README.md index a5fff02..2812543 100644 --- a/README.md +++ b/README.md @@ -12,7 +12,7 @@ A Carvel package for [secretgen-controller](https://github.com/carvel-dev/secret ### Prerequisites -* Kubernetes 1.27+ +* Kubernetes 1.28+ * Carvel [`kctrl`](https://carvel.dev/kapp-controller/docs/latest/install/#installing-kapp-controller-cli-kctrl) CLI. * Carvel [kapp-controller](https://carvel.dev/kapp-controller) deployed in your Kubernetes cluster. You can install it with Carvel [`kapp`](https://carvel.dev/kapp/docs/latest/install) (recommended choice) or `kubectl`. diff --git a/package/config/upstream/release.yml b/package/config/upstream/release.yml index 40e3cc7..7470433 100644 --- a/package/config/upstream/release.yml +++ b/package/config/upstream/release.yml @@ -801,11 +801,11 @@ metadata: - git: dirty: true remoteURL: https://github.com/carvel-dev/secretgen-controller - sha: 8b4e61a29dfd282f659ef1ffb96a779920260553 + sha: 0dc3c44ea5c32b766140fa0d85e80b61d19e9029 tags: - - v0.17.0 - url: ghcr.io/carvel-dev/secretgen-controller@sha256:e1da9e311956ae4cbb8ca434d243c947e2d66770d06689da840ffc77988babdc - secretgen-controller.carvel.dev/version: v0.17.0 + - v0.18.0 + url: ghcr.io/carvel-dev/secretgen-controller@sha256:35060c30363c1806c137bd137edda0d1dd07442cf1372f1951b194b3b11f5b59 + secretgen-controller.carvel.dev/version: v0.18.0 name: secretgen-controller namespace: secretgen-controller spec: @@ -820,7 +820,7 @@ spec: app: secretgen-controller spec: containers: - - image: ghcr.io/carvel-dev/secretgen-controller@sha256:e1da9e311956ae4cbb8ca434d243c947e2d66770d06689da840ffc77988babdc + - image: ghcr.io/carvel-dev/secretgen-controller@sha256:35060c30363c1806c137bd137edda0d1dd07442cf1372f1951b194b3b11f5b59 name: secretgen-controller resources: requests: @@ -833,6 +833,8 @@ spec: - ALL readOnlyRootFilesystem: true runAsNonRoot: true + seccompProfile: + type: RuntimeDefault serviceAccount: secretgen-controller-sa --- apiVersion: v1 diff --git a/package/vendir.lock.yml b/package/vendir.lock.yml index 3f43449..a751924 100644 --- a/package/vendir.lock.yml +++ b/package/vendir.lock.yml @@ -2,8 +2,8 @@ apiVersion: vendir.k14s.io/v1alpha1 directories: - contents: - githubRelease: - tag: v0.17.0 - url: https://api.github.com/repos/carvel-dev/secretgen-controller/releases/138771550 + tag: v0.18.0 + url: https://api.github.com/repos/carvel-dev/secretgen-controller/releases/153293085 path: . path: config/upstream kind: LockConfig diff --git a/package/vendir.yml b/package/vendir.yml index 9e643de..d2ab7cb 100755 --- a/package/vendir.yml +++ b/package/vendir.yml @@ -4,7 +4,7 @@ directories: - githubRelease: disableAutoChecksumValidation: true slug: carvel-dev/secretgen-controller - tag: v0.17.0 + tag: v0.18.0 includePaths: - release.yml path: . diff --git a/test/setup/kind/v1.28/kind-config.yml b/test/setup/kind/v1.28/kind-config.yml index 8c67fca..88636af 100644 --- a/test/setup/kind/v1.28/kind-config.yml +++ b/test/setup/kind/v1.28/kind-config.yml @@ -3,6 +3,6 @@ kind: Cluster apiVersion: kind.x-k8s.io/v1alpha4 nodes: - role: control-plane - image: kindest/node:v1.28.7 + image: kindest/node:v1.28.9 - role: worker - image: kindest/node:v1.28.7 + image: kindest/node:v1.28.9 diff --git a/test/setup/kind/v1.29/kind-config.yml b/test/setup/kind/v1.29/kind-config.yml index 8dea726..1284fef 100644 --- a/test/setup/kind/v1.29/kind-config.yml +++ b/test/setup/kind/v1.29/kind-config.yml @@ -3,6 +3,6 @@ kind: Cluster apiVersion: kind.x-k8s.io/v1alpha4 nodes: - role: control-plane - image: kindest/node:v1.29.2 + image: kindest/node:v1.29.4 - role: worker - image: kindest/node:v1.29.2 + image: kindest/node:v1.29.4 diff --git a/test/setup/kind/v1.27/kind-config.yml b/test/setup/kind/v1.30/kind-config.yml similarity index 61% rename from test/setup/kind/v1.27/kind-config.yml rename to test/setup/kind/v1.30/kind-config.yml index 36a8d8a..a477444 100644 --- a/test/setup/kind/v1.27/kind-config.yml +++ b/test/setup/kind/v1.30/kind-config.yml @@ -3,6 +3,6 @@ kind: Cluster apiVersion: kind.x-k8s.io/v1alpha4 nodes: - role: control-plane - image: kindest/node:v1.27.11 + image: kindest/node:v1.30.0 - role: worker - image: kindest/node:v1.27.11 + image: kindest/node:v1.30.0